We've done E21 trips to the Alps before back in 2010 and 2011 (click for a photo report). The past few years have been way too busy even though we were able to do our annual Ardennes or Eifel trips! But we'll be back in the Alps this year. Leaving on June 1st right after the Sharknose Meeting we will tour legendary French Alps roads and even make a brief Italian sidestep. The basis will be to follow the wonderful Route des Grandes Alpes.

With professional guidance and communication equipment, a different hotel for each night, tools and spares available and even a mandatory technical scrutineering session beforehand we try to accomplish that we will have a relaxed and trouble free time of enjoying our cars and the scenery, in good company! Sofar 5 teams have enrolled and all preparations have started!

After the tour we plan to drive over to Dijon, France on June 5 to visit the Grand Prix de l'Age d'Or (June 5-7). A wonderful event quite similar to the Le Mans Classic where we will join the BMW club stands including the French Atelier E21 community for another celebration of 40 years of E21, and see some magnificent classic BMW racing.
